I bought this game for 15 bucks on sale years ago and after a few minutes of play time, it sat in my steam library never really given a chance to show its true colors. Recently, a few of my friends picked up the handsome collection when it went on sale and we decided to take break from our mostly pvp competitive multiplayer focused games and started up this coop masterpiece. After spending so much time in destiny and even more hardcore titles in the genre like Escape from Tarkov and Dayz, BL2 was like a breath of fresh air. Refreshing combat, loots is fair and interesting, an extensive skill tree makes what should be straightforward shoot and loot much more varied which is only made better by the large roster of enemy types. It's a great, fun experience that doesn't take itself too seriously, and that's a great thing in this genre.

Words really can't describe how I feel about this game. It came out some time when I was in 7th grade and (thankfully) it wasn't as popular as it should've been where I lived. Its been 7 years since this game came out. I finished high school, got a job, and was finally able to afford a laptop and play this game. I've heard stories of how this game redefined visuals, and honestly, you can tell. The graphics and animation of this game are up to snuff with some of the best indie games available on Steam. From a 7 year old game, thats saying things. But what really drew me in and made me not wanna stop playing was the story. SEVEN YEARS OF MY LIFE spent dodging any kind of spoilers about bioshock. I never read or watched a single review about the first or even its predecessors, 2 and infinite, in hopes of savoring the storyline all that much more when I actually played it. And ♥♥♥♥ was I not dissapointed. Dark, abbysmal atmosphere coupled with some real spooks, and the ever inspiring respect demanded by each and every big daddy. That intense buildup leading to the massive reveal was some of the best story direction I've ever experienced. From this ♥♥♥♥♥♥♥ seven year old game. If you haven't experienced bioshock, the oldest of the series, buy it. Play it. I don't care if you're all about next gen graphics and streamlined gameplay, Bioshock told one of the best stories in this decade of gaming, and its absolutely paramount that you experience it for yourself.
